> > > That worked but it cycled from the default resolution to a "way too
> > > big" size so I tried adding (well my son at home actually)
> > >
> > > X_MODE_0 = 800x600
> > > X_MODE_1 = 1024x768
> >
> > You put it like this:-
> >
> >         X_MODE_0           = 1024x768 800x600
Didn't this work?
Goes ok for me.
